W.R. Berkley (WRB) Misses Q3 EPS by 6c
October 20, 2020 4:12 PM EDTW.R. Berkley (NYSE: WRB) reported Q3 EPS of $0.65, $0.06 worse than the analyst estimate of $0.71.
Third quarter highlights included:
Average rate increases excluding workers' compensation were approximately 14.5%.The reported combined ratio was 93.7%.
